Don’t you wish print was easier to read? Here’s your answer! This pacy crime thriller has been published in a LARGE PRINT format that’s dyslexia-friendly too.

Once business gets personal. there’s no escape…

Andrew Aycliffe’s job interview was hell. This is the story of his revenge.

It’s also the tale of Jed Gardner, an IT genius who prefers computers, music and trains to human beings - that is, until he meets Melissa Stevens. But she’s about to marry boring Boris Brooks.

Three love triangles, two murders and a fraud case later, is anyone left to live happily ever after?

With jaw-dropping twists and a surprise ending, this very British thriller grips you by the throat and won’t let go.

Printed in Verdana 14 point with 1.5 line spacing. The large print in sans serif font, wide line spacing, cream paper and short chapters make this edition a breeze to read. Helpful to readers with visual impairment or visual stress, and dyslexic readers. Also available in traditional paperback and e-book formats.
